Output 66c587dd115d41b4a231ca47ea68eed24e9bbf6ed67c95093e11036db49c3418:4

value
11940222
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f855e558cf3ec0b3f64c06a4af25062639ceda4a OP_EQUALVERIFY OP_CHECKSIG
address
1Pe5Uj362HFpgvJJJnjqhoZ6FXrVSmhCku
transaction
66c587dd115d41b4a231ca47ea68eed24e9bbf6ed67c95093e11036db49c3418
spent
true